The highly anticipated auction for **The Block 2025** took place in **Daylesford**, with five teams competing for the coveted **$100,000** winner’s prize. As the grand finale aired, viewers tuned in to witness the culmination of a season filled with innovative designs and intense competition.
Teams Showcase Unique Designs
This season, participants faced a unique challenge, as all five teams were tasked with constructing brand new homes, each following an identical floorplan. Despite this commonality, the finished products showcased strikingly different styles and concepts.
**Emma and Ben’s** House 1 stood out as the only elevated home, offering breathtaking views that other contestants could not match. The couple infused their design with a charming country aesthetic, reflecting the local character of Daylesford.
**Han and Can**, responsible for House 2, encountered significant budgeting challenges but ultimately delivered a stunning spa-inspired retreat, complete with serene Japanese gardens. Their design emphasized tranquility, appealing to potential buyers seeking a peaceful haven.
**Britt and Taz** opted for a wellness theme in House 3, featuring a sauna, ice bath, and a fully equipped Pilates studio. This bold choice, made in lieu of a second living area, sparked controversy but positioned them as strong contenders.
House 4, crafted by **Sonny and Alicia**, embodied modern industrial vibes. While they did not secure a room win until the final week, their design could be the deciding factor in the competition. They earned a **$50,000** reduction on their reserve price and a car for both themselves and the buyer of their property, along with a **$260,000** Titanium caravan for the new owner.
Lastly, **Robby and Mat’s** House 5 showcased a contemporary country style, enhanced by a prime location adjacent to the **Wombat Park Estate**. Features like an underground wine cellar and a pickleball court have made this house a favorite among viewers and experts alike, with many predicting that it could rival House 3 for the title.
